Output 258d23cc40ddc9e5b46ecbb01f5249ec6199d4f8342a9e2f63f68ced32bcc42e:0

value
2880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6a4c47bf27ace4af392183e09deaf4729b97564 OP_EQUAL
address
3KoM6mqghfxjFpdvVTdrZxJQ7oNuaPmE6L
transaction
258d23cc40ddc9e5b46ecbb01f5249ec6199d4f8342a9e2f63f68ced32bcc42e
spent
true